This #JEMLegacy tweet highlights two papers from 1965 by Drs. Phil Gold and Samuel O. Freedman @mcgill.ca on the discovery of the Carcinoembryonic Antigen (CEA), the basis for the widely used CEA blood test.

A small primer on the #NobelPrize awarded to Mary E. Brunkow, Fred Ramsdell and Shimon Sakaguchi today. This prize was for combining two separate fields of immunology research - genetic research on IPEX and immunology research of regulatory T cells (#Tregs), with enormous impact on biology/medicine

Humans are exposed to fungi, inhaling hundred/thousands of spores daily. Immunocompromised patients (chemo, transplant) are at risk for certain fungal infections. But, what about people who don't have these risk factors? This enigma has peppered the literature...
This review from @donvinh.bsky.social highlights the diversity in intrinsic fungal susceptibility across individuals and populations, through genetic- and autoantibody-mediated processes. rupress.org/jem/article/...
